Abstract

The invention discloses an LLC resonant converter with a wide load range. Load current of the LLC resonant converter directly flows through a secondary winding of a variable inductor, so that a resonance inductance value in a resonant network is controlled to be changed with the change of output current, such as, the variable resonance inductance value is the minimum when the output current is the maximum, and the ratio between an excitation inductance value of a transformer is the minimum, thus a high full load efficiency can be obtained; while with the decrease of the output current, the variable resonance inductance value increases, and the ratio between the excitation inductance value of the transformer increases, thus the load output range is widened; and on the premise of obtaining constant current characteristics of wide range load current, the LLC resonant converter with provided by the invention can obtain a relatively high efficiency, and meanwhile, the LLC resonant converter and a control circuit are of a simple structure, and a complicated driving device and a drive and control circuit are not needed, thereby reaching the purpose of reducing the circuit cost and improving the efficiency and stability of a driver.

Description

technical field [0001] The invention belongs to the field of DC / DC converters and LED lighting, and in particular relates to an LLC resonant conversion device with a wide load range. Background technique [0002] After the 21st century, LED has been rapidly promoted and applied as a new generation of green lighting. With the development of new technologies, further improving lighting efficiency and improving the lighting environment, LED lighting with higher power and dimming output has gradually become a new development trend. LLC resonant converter, because of its own working characteristics, can achieve high efficiency, high power density and high stability, so it can be widely concerned and applied.
